Skip to main content
Skip header
Terminated in academic year 2009/2010

Visual Basic II

Type of study Master
Language of instruction Czech
Code 354-0553/01
Abbreviation VB II
Course title Visual Basic II
Credits 3
Coordinating department Department of Robotics
Course coordinator prof. Dr. Ing. Petr Novák

Subject syllabus

1 Objektové programování
Opakování, tvorba vlastních tříd, instancí objektů, vlastností, metod
a událostí.
2 Přetěžování funkcí a operátorů
Ukázka práce s přetěžováním na konkrétním příkladě (zavedení
komplexních čísel)
3 Úvod do vektorové grafiky (GDI+)
Základní možnosti knihovny GDI+, kreslení čar, obrazců, transformace,
barvy.
4 Vektorová grafika – objektový přístup
Tvorba vlastních grafických objektů
5 Úvod do bitmapové grafiky
Práce s bitmapovou grafikou, grafické efekty (rozostření, převod do
stupňů šedi atd.)
6 Bitmapová grafika – detekce hran, rozpoznávání objektů
Příklad na detekci hran, rozpoznání jednotlivých jednoduchých objektů
v obraze.
7 Základy komunikace v počítačové síti (TCP/IP)
Demonstrace základů síťové komunikace (architektura klient – server)
8 Tvorba klient/server aplikací
Tvorba jednoduchého komunikačního programu na bázi klient/server
aplikací.
9 Komunikace prostřednictvím sériového portu (RS232)
Ukázka komunikace prostřednictvím sériového portu počítače.
10 Komunikace mezi aplikacemi
Tvorba dvou vzájemně komunikujících aplikací.
11 Úvod do programování pro MS PocketPC (Windows Mobile)
Demonstrace tvorby, nahrání a spouštění aplikací pro PDA se systémem
Windows Mobile
12 Tvorba vlastních DLL knihoven ve VB
Ukázka tvorby vlastní knihovny funkcí.
13 Úvod do TrueVision3D
Tvorba základní scény a jednoduchých 3D objektů.
14 Rezerva, zápočet
Kontrola projektů, udělení zápočtů.

Literature

www.microsoft.com

Advised literature

No advised literature has been specified for this subject.